Episode notes
The primary psychoactive substance in tobacco is nicotine.
As basis for misuse and dependence, nicotine makes associated health and behavioral health disorders associated with tobacco difficult to treat.
Because of nicotine tolerance and withdrawal, a diagnosis of Tobacco Related Use Disorder often requires clinical intervention.
